HoMM 3 Dungeon is supporting
MM7 For Blood and Honor.
It depicts Warlocks of Nignon and the units can eventualy be met in very close,almost intimate, personal contact in that game-Minotaurs,Beholders (Manticores was planned but not included )etc.
While HoMM V has it own continent and it is not
Erathia of HoMM III ,so dungeon is Dark Elven here.They both are good ,frankly, but serve to different purposes.
Eventually Dark Elves campaign was my fav
